COLUMBIA, SC (July 29, 2013) – A Powerball® ticket worth $1 MILLION was purchased from the seemingly aptly named Winners Circle Mini Mart at 500 N. Main St. in Bethune for Saturday night’s drawing.
The ticket sold in Bethune matched all five white ball numbers drawn. Had the ticket holder purchased PowerPlay® for an extra $1, the $1 million prize would have increased to $2 MILLION.

The odds of winning $1 million are 1 in 5,153,633.
The estimated jackpot for Wednesday night’s drawing is $235 million.
Proceeds from every dollar spent by players on the South Carolina Education Lottery are returned to the state in the form of funding for education, prizes, retailer commissions, and payment to contractors for goods and services.
